Weinsteins close to snatching Miramax back from Disney?

According to THR, the Weinsteins are close to a winning bid in the Miramax auction and could take back operating control of the arthouse studio they founded in 1979, then sold to Disney for $80 million in 1993. Disney’s recently shuttered niche division boasts a 611-title film library. Miramax founders Harvey and Bob Weinstein have ….

Actor James Caan’s Openfilm to award $1 million film financing prize in indie film contest

Online global independent film community Openfilm announced that it will award $1 million to independent filmmakers over the next 20 months. One independent filmmaker will be selected to receive $50,000 in cash and $200,000 in financing every 5 months by the Openfilm community of 20,000 registered film enthusiasts, along with some of the world’s preeminent ….

Indie filmmakers continue to find a voice during upcoming 32nd Annual Independent Film Week

Independent Film Week is the oldest and largest forum in the U.S. for the discovery of new projects in development and new voices on the independent film scene. The Project Forum is a meetings-driven forum connecting filmmakers who have new narrative and documentary projects with key industry executives interested in identifying projects with which to ….
